As of June 2026, TruNorth grades Anthropic an overall B (50/100) across nine values categories. State lobbying: ~$320K annual state/city lobbying spend across CA (2024). (source: Public records research). Stanford FMTI Dec2025 foundation-model transparency: 46/100 — mid-tier; gaps remain on data sourcing, data-laborer practices, or downstream-harm reporting. (source: fmti).
